Perhaps Mother did say something like that, although I don't remember reading it anywhere.

Although, I do think that Holy Mother believed that illness (at least in the case of herself & the Master) was brought on mainly by initiating devotees.

On 19th September, 1918, Mother said to Sarayubala Devi: "People have hives and get well again; but if I get anything it seems unwilling to leave me. The Master used to say all the diseases and sorrows of the people who came to see and touch him, found refuge in his body. I suppose it is the same with me."
(excerpted from "In The Company Of The Holy Mother")

Swami Tadatmananda Has Left the Body

Swami Tadamananda passed away this morning. It appears that he knew the time had come. He called his brothers to his bedside and requested they chant and read from the Gospel of Sri Ramakrishna. He remained conscious throughout, up until his passing.
